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
ANSYS Fluent
- Solver seats and HPC packs are licensed separately, and the packs scale by core count, so the cost of running a large case in parallel can exceed the base licence several times over and is the line item that surprises first-time buyers.
- Ansys does not publish any pricing, and quotes vary widely by region, industry and negotiating position, so a smaller firm has no way to know whether it is being charged fairly relative to a large account.
- Synopsys completed its acquisition of Ansys in July 2025 and started shipping combined capabilities in 2026; packaging, bundling and account teams are changing, and buyers on multi-year agreements should expect renewal terms to be renegotiated on a different basis.
- Getting trustworthy results demands genuine CFD expertise in meshing, turbulence model selection and convergence assessment, so the licence is useless without a specialist, and the specialist is harder to hire than the software is to buy.
- Licences are typically served from a network licence manager, which means concurrent-use contention inside a busy simulation group; engineers queue for solver tokens, and organisations end up buying spare seats purely to avoid the queue.
Aras Innovator
- Aras publishes no prices at all, so you cannot sanity-check a quote against a list price and every negotiation starts from the vendor knowing more than you do.
- The platform ships as a toolkit rather than a configured process, so a first implementation is typically a six to twelve month engagement with an integrator, and services frequently cost more than the first two years of subscription.
- The Community Edition is capped at 50 named users, gets only annual releases and excludes Aras-performed upgrades, so it is a genuine free tier but a deliberately awkward place to stay.
- Configuration flexibility invites over-customisation; organisations that model every local exception end up with a system only two internal people understand, which is the same trap they left their previous PLM to escape.
- CAD connectors are not all equal in maturity, and some are excluded from the base subscription, so a shop standardised on a less common CAD tool should confirm connector scope in writing before signing.

Answered from the vendors’ own pages
ANSYS Fluent: How much does Fluent cost?
Ansys does not publish pricing. Expect an annual lease per solver seat plus separately licensed HPC packs for parallel cores, with the total for a serious capability running into six figures a year.
Aras Innovator: Is Aras Innovator open source?
No. The source is not open. The Community Edition is free of licence fee for up to 50 named users under a revocable licence, which is not the same thing.
ANSYS Fluent: Is Fluent still an Ansys product?
Yes, but Ansys is now part of Synopsys following the acquisition that completed in July 2025, and the two portfolios are being combined.
Aras Innovator: Can I buy a perpetual licence?
No. Aras sells subscription only. If a perpetual PLM licence is a procurement requirement, Aras is out.
ANSYS Fluent: Can OpenFOAM do the same job?
Numerically it can cover a lot of the same physics at no licence cost, but it lacks the meshing workflow, support and the validation pedigree that certification and customer specifications often require.
Aras Innovator: Do upgrades cost extra?
No, and that is the central commercial claim. Aras performs upgrades of subscriber environments, including customised ones, as part of the subscription.
ANSYS Fluent: Is there a free version?
There is a student edition with cell count limits, suitable for learning but not for production work.
Aras Innovator: How many modules do I have to buy?
One subscription covers all applications. Some CAD connectors are the exception, so confirm yours is in scope.
